Transaction b3a63b911f012691e7dc94914ab0391320c9479790bd984345603d8532d0a63c

2 Input
2 Outputs
  • b3a63b911f012691e7dc94914ab0391320c9479790bd984345603d8532d0a63c:0
  • value  4526162
    address  38TcbtUYtR1izFu2sTebkfhZ4a59hoj4UM
  • b3a63b911f012691e7dc94914ab0391320c9479790bd984345603d8532d0a63c:1
  • value  1145935
    address  32NtD8bbkdAPJQ76JdzcZaAuTpREhPufeX